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

Assists in the design, development, and validation of mechanical systems for cutting and spreading machines in accordance with established product inputs

Also supports Sustaining Engineering, Continuous Improvement and Support to Quality, Manufacturing, Purchasing Production Control and Sales for existing products

Assists to design, develop, analyze, and document product designs to meet the functional, quality, cost, reliability, manufacturability, and safety requirements

Designs, develops, and tests all aspects of mechanical components and systems as a part of new Product development

Supports project success by meeting schedule, budget, performance, and quality requirements

Assists in the creation of project technical file documentation that includes drawings, engineering files, supplier communications and Engineering Change Notices (ECN's)

Participates in product design reviews and risk assessment

Ensures designs meet the requirements of all regulatory requirements (CE UL/CSA)

Provides production support to maintain quality and production output

Provides technical support to Manufacturing, Production Control, Purchasing, Tech Service and Sales as required

Required Skills / Qualifications:

*

Bachelor's degree or higher in Mechanical Engineering

3-5 years of mechanical design experience

Successfully completed coursework and demonstrates proficiency relative to several to the following:

Structural, enclosure, electromechanical/motion control system design

A solid understanding of the principles of heat transfer and fluid flow

An understanding of fabrication techniques such as machining, bent metal, welding

Knowledge of the application of industry design and documentation standards (ASME, GD&T)

Proficiency in Computer Aided Design (SolidWorks), AutoCAD, Microsoft Project and other MS Office products
